After reading the post on foam filling of tires I decided to give it a try for the idler tires on my Snow Bird project. I went to the shop where I've been doing business with for 20 years and checked with them. I was quoted to repair the two tires that I was having trouble with(the other 4 were ok)it would cost $150.00 to do the foam. I'm going to try this being there the idler wheels and will not carry any of the car weight. I also checked on having two more ( these are all old "hard" Sears Riverside ones) mounted with new tubes and the quoit was $25.00 each and I provide the tire,tube and rim and $16.00 to fix a flat. These are 30x3.5 demountable I feel that this isn't that bad after fighting with a few over the years.(I'm not getting any younger)
I'll see how this will work(sorry for the 4 letter word). The weight of the foam tire is 50lb. each,I know that air filled tire are less.
